I've been struggling with eczema for years, and my doctor recently prescribed Tridesilon 0.05% Cream. I've heard it's a mild steroid cream that helps reduce redness, swelling, and itching, but I'm a bit nervous about the potential side effects. I've read about some serious ones like allergic reactions and high blood sugar, but I'm hoping to hear from others who've used it. How effective was it for you? Did you experience any side effects? Any tips on how to use it safely and effectively would be greatly appreciated!
